Distributed Ledger Infrastructure : The Backbone of Digital Money
Blockchain technology has emerged as a revolutionary force in the realm of finance, serving as the bedrock for digital currencies and transforming how we exchange value. Its inherent characteristics, such as immutability, transparency, and security, make it an ideal platform for building trust and facilitating secure transactions. By leveraging cryptography and a distributed network of computers, blockchain enables peer-to-peer interactions without the need for intermediaries, fostering a more autonomous financial system.
The decentralized nature of blockchain reduces the risk of single points of failure and fraud, ensuring the integrity and authenticity of digital records. This inherent trust structure has paved the way for the adoption of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, which have achieved widespread recognition as legitimate forms of payment.
- Additionally, blockchain technology holds immense potential beyond digital currencies, with applications spanning diverse industries such as supply chain management, healthcare, and voting systems.

Understanding the Risks and Rewards of Digital Currency Investments
Digital currencies, like Bitcoin and Ethereum, have surged in popularity in recent years, attracting both savvy traders. While the potential for substantial gains is alluring, it's crucial to fully grasp the inherent risks involved.
One major risk is instability, as digital currency prices read more can swing wildly in short periods. This volatile nature makes it essential to invest only what you can afford to risk.
Another concern is the limited governance surrounding digital currencies. This leaves markets vulnerable to illicit activity, so it's vital to conduct thorough research and choose reputable exchanges and platforms.
- Moreover, technological advancements and regulatory changes can drastically alter the digital currency landscape, requiring investors to stay updated of industry developments.
Despite these risks, digital currencies also offer attractive opportunities. Their decentralized nature can provide greater transparency and security.
Ultimately, understanding both the risks and rewards is paramount for making strategic capital allocations. Remember to invest responsibly, diversify your portfolio, and always conduct due diligence before committing funds.
